What is the most common form of reproduction for prokaryotes?
Asexual reproduction
Steps of Binary Fission (Describe Each Stage)
Elongation and chromosomal replication
Septation
Cell separation
Conjugation
The transfer of genetic material between bacterial cells either by direct cell to cell contact or by a bridge-like connection between two cells
Transduction
When a bacteriophage infects a bacterial cell, it incorporates its genome into its host cell
Transformation
Recipients pick up DNA fragments from a cell that has been lysed. These fragments are incorporated into recipient cell’s genome which leaves the cell transformed.
